Biographical/historical information
The first campus radio station was WWWS (91.3 FM), founded in the 1950s ann located in Joyner Library. In 1982 the station changed to WZMB, which is run by East Carolina University Student Media Board and located in the basement of the former Mendenhall Student Center.
WECU-TV was founded in 1954 and housed near the School of Education. A new studio was completed near the medical campus in early 1972. The station closed permanently at the beginning of 2010 due to budgetary issues.

Container list
Raw footage of John Tucker interviewing Janice Faulkner, Scott Wells, and Lou McNamee about their recollections of Senator John F. Kennedy's visit to East Carolina College on the presidential campaign trail. Includes some of Kennedy's speech, including an introduction by Louis Gaylord.
